Didn’t think we were at our best. 

First half we strolled it. Had we picked our game up we’d have been comfortably ahead by the break. 

Second half I felt we were second best. If Sammon was a finisher it’d have been a different story. 

Broadfoot for me was excellent as was Findlay beside him. Power and Dicker did a lot of hard graft. 

Felt they restricted us in wide areas. Our fullbacks didn’t get the room to bomb on. 

JJ produced a great cross for the goal but his final ball was poor. Too many miss hits from Boyd and Erwin in good areas. Mulumbu has a poor game and for me was heading for a second yellow for cheap fouls. 

I thought MacDonald looked really nervy. One in the second half looked routine but he chested it out and Broadfoot saved the day. Some of his punches lacked conviction as well. One very good save when Sammon tried to poke it under him though. Another clean sheet so I’m sure he’ll be content. 

If we show up for a full 90minutes against these bottom six sides we could give one of them a real hiding. Performances haven’t been brilliant in recent weeks but progress has us winning these games now when we’d have dropped points before
